on the way back from dogs walk on Monday came across a wasps nest in the ground disturbed by my dog, and they were pretty angry

Had my 2 boys (ages 2 and 4) and the dog with me and despite picking up my boys and running got stung 9 times (the boys got stung twice each - that was the worst bit )

My boys stings have almost gone today but mine have swelled up quite badly (doc reckons its something to do with my hayfever allergy) also on anti-hist pills until they subside

So - avoid those wasps nests people - they hurt like b*ggery!
